Vernasca Cement Plant is a cement plant in Italy with a reported capacity of 1,300,000 t of cement. It burns limestone in high-temperature rotary kilns to make clinker and cement. It is operated by Buzzi SpA. By capacity it ranks #11 of 29 cement plants tracked in Italy. It emits about 302,423 tonnes of CO₂e per year (Climate TRACE) — roughly the tailpipe emissions of 70,495 cars. Its CO₂ per unit of capacity is about 35% below the median cement plant.
